Todd Hughes, former senior vice president of technology of BigBear.ai (NYSE: BBAI), has been appointed VP and chief innovation officer at autonomous software provider Scientific Systems Company Inc.
Hughes will lead SSCI’s efforts to grow its work in the artificial intelligence-powered mission autonomy software area, the company said Thursday.
While at BigBear, Hughes led a research and development team focused on the development of data-driven decision support tools. He previously served as technical director for strategic projects and initiatives at CACI International (NYSE: CACI) and chief technology officer at Next Century Corp., where he held an eight-year career prior to that company’s sale to CACI in October 2019.
Hughes also held managerial roles at the Defense Advanced Research Projects Agency and Lockheed Martin’s (NYSE: LMT) Advanced Technology Laboratories.
